Weapons Support Detachment:Korea
U.S. Army
Weapons Support Detachment/Korea (WSD-K) is a United States military unit established to provide specialized logistical and technical support for U.S. forces stationed on the Korean Peninsula. The unit’s primary mission is believed to involve the maintenance, security, and readiness of special weapons and their associated systems, playing a critical role in the U.S.-Republic of Korea alliance's deterrence posture. Historically, WSD-K has operated with a high degree of secrecy, reflecting the sensitive nature of its responsibilities and its contribution to regional stability. Over the years, the unit has adapted to evolving strategic requirements, ensuring that U.S. commitments to the defense of South Korea remain credible and effective.
58th ATC Battalion
U.S. Army
The 58th Air Traffic Control (ATC) Battalion was originally activated during the Vietnam War era to provide critical air traffic services for U.S. Army aviation units. Throughout its history, the battalion has been responsible for managing and coordinating airspace, ensuring the safe movement of military aircraft in both combat and peacetime operations. The 58th ATC Battalion has deployed in support of major operations, including Operation Desert Storm and Operation Iraqi Freedom, where it established and operated tactical ATC facilities. Today, the battalion remains a vital component of Army aviation, supporting global missions with advanced airspace management and control capabilities.
92nd Engineer BN
U.S. Army
The 92nd Engineer Battalion, known as the "Black Diamonds," was first constituted on 1 October 1933 and activated at Fort Leonard Wood, Missouri, in 1941. The battalion served with distinction in World War II, participating in campaigns across North Africa and Italy, including the Rome-Arno and Po Valley operations. Over the decades, the 92nd Engineer Battalion has supported numerous missions, including deployments to Vietnam, Southwest Asia during Operation Desert Storm, and more recently, Operations Iraqi Freedom and Enduring Freedom. Renowned for its versatility, the battalion provides combat engineer support, construction, and mobility operations, earning several commendations for its service.
